You are able to publish any test you have created as an Exam that your learners complete online.
To publish a test you must first create a test manually or with the Test Generator.
Publish an Online Test
- Log into EchoExam using your Instructor account.
- From the My Library tab, select Tests from the menu.
- Click the three vertical dots to open the action menu and select Publish.
You may also click Publish within the Test Editor.
- Choose a Course Record from the drop-down to publish the test to or search and select a specific course.
- Optionally, you may change the Exam Name.
The Exam Name is pre-filled with the test name and the date.
- Click Show Settings.
The settings for the Exam are shown. Click Hide Settings to hide them.
-
Exam Settings - These settings are disabled by default.
- Show score - When enabled, the learner sees final points or percentage score after submitting the test.
- Show results - When enabled, the learner will see which questions they answered correctly and incorrectly when submitting their attempt.
- Randomize answers - When enabled, answer options are displayed in random order each time a learner takes the test.
- Randomize questions - When enabled, questions are displayed in random order each time a learner takes the test.
- Browser lock - Prevents learners from viewing additional tabs or using other applications on their device while taking the exam.
-
Number of Attempts - Set from 1 to 10 or Unlimited. This defines the number of times each learner can submit the exam in the scheduled time.
-
Submitted Score - This option appears when more than one attempt is set for the exam and allows the instructor to choose how the exam grade will be calculated for learners. Highest Score is selected by default.
- Highest Score - Takes the highest score attempt that the learner submitted.
- Average Score - Takes the average score from all attempts that the learner submitted.
- Last Attempt - Takes the score from the most recent attempt that the learner submitted.

Passing Score - Set a minimum score that the learner has to achieve to pass the test.
- Points - Set a minimum number of points needed to pass the test.
- Percentage - Set a minimum percentage needed to pass the test.

- Click Save.
When you click Save, your exam is created within the selected course, but it is not yet available to learners. You must first access a course directly to adjust the roster for the exam (if desired) and to set the start / end date / times for the exam (if desired). Next, from My Courses > Exam, you need to click Assign to make the exam either immediately available, or available at the start date / time you selected.
